Causes include shin splints or medial tibial stress syndrome, stress fractures and compartment syndrome.
Shin splints are caused by stress on your shinbone and the connective tissues that attach muscles to your bones, causing inflammation and pain in the shins. Shin pain can result from shin splints, tight shoes, foot deformities, fractures, or excess weight Shin splints manifest as pain along the tibia or shin bone, and they are among the most common running injuries Most people get them if they’re new to the sport or after ramping up their mileage. The shin, medically known as the anterior leg, is a critical anatomical region located between the knee and the ankle
At the core of this anatomical region lies the tibia, the larger of the two long bones that form the lower leg.
